WebJul 13, 2015 · The Australian government has launched a consultation on the introduction of a foreign resident capital gains withholding tax. On 6 November 2013, the Australian government announced that it would proceed with a 10 per cent non-final withholding tax on the disposal, by foreign residents, of certain taxable Australian property. WebThe tax is generally withheld (NRA withholding) from the payment made to the foreign person. The term NRA withholding is used in this area descriptively to refer to withholding required under sections 1441, 1442, and 1443 of the Internal Revenue Code. Web2 days ago · A 15% withholding tax applies to interest payable from a South African source to non-residents on certain debt instruments. The resident payer of the interest is required to deduct the 15% withholding tax from the payment. No domestic withholding tax is levied on fees payable to non-residents.
